The problem is that stadium-wise, people will always fill up that stadium because if Cowboys fans won't buy the tickets, their opponent's fans will.

We can all talk about not doing this and not doing that, and we can even do what we say we will, but the reality is that until this team goes through multiple really bad seasons (5 or less wins), it's going to keep making more money year over year, and honestly, even multiple bad seasons may not be enough at least in the short term.
